Over half the state defeated their school budgets on Tuesday, and Gov. Chris Christie believes this shows that people want more reform. Christie again made public comments saying that property taxes should be capped at a 2.5 percent increase year-to-year. He also urged for more reforms when it comes to public workers benefits and pensions. Democrats have focused on reinstituting the “Millionaire’s Tax” as a way to bring more revenue into the state and fix some of the problems.
